1. The Value Proposition: Is a 12-Year-Old Kia K5 a Steal or a Flop? ๐ค
When it comes to buying a 12-year-old Kia K5, the first question on everyoneโs mind is: How much should I expect to pay? The good news? These cars can often be found for a fraction of their original price.
On average, a 12-year-old Kia K5 might set you back anywhere from $2,000 to $5,000, depending on its condition, mileage, and location. But hereโs the catch: While the price tag might look appealing, you need to factor in potential maintenance costs and the overall reliability of the vehicle. ๐ ๏ธ
2. Reliability Check: Can This Car Go the Distance? ๐ฃ๏ธ
Kia has a reputation for building reliable vehicles, and the K5 (known as the Optima in some markets) is no exception. However, a 12-year-old car is bound to have its fair share of wear and tear.
Key areas to inspect include the engine, transmission, brakes, and suspension. Make sure to get a pre-purchase inspection from a trusted mechanic. If the car checks out, it could be a solid investment. But if there are major issues, it might be better to walk away. ๐ฆ

4. Future Considerations: Is a 12-Year-Old Car a Long-Term Solution? ๐ฐ๏ธ
Buying a 12-year-old car means youโre dealing with an older technology base. While the K5 is known for its durability, you might face higher repair costs and limited access to modern features like advanced safety systems and infotainment options.
If youโre looking for a short-term solution or a budget-friendly ride, a 12-year-old Kia K5 could be a great choice. But if youโre planning to keep the car for several years, you might want to consider a more recent model. ๐
